Ingredients

For the Salad

  • 1 red delicious apple
  • 1 granny smith apple
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 2 cups matchstick carrots (you can usually buy precut bags at the grocery store)
  • 1/4 cup yellow onion, finely diced
  • 1/3 cup dried sweetened cranberries
  • 1 cup canned mandarin segments, drained

For the Dressing

  • 1/2 cup vanilla yogurt
  • 1/4 cup mayo
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per

For Garnish

  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, finely chopped
Carrot

How to Make Carrot Apple Salad

Step 1: Prepare the Apples

Cut both apples matchstick style and place them in a mixing bowl. Pour lemon juice over them to prevent browning.

Step 2: Soak Apples

Set aside for about 5 minutes so the apples can soak up the lemon juice.

Step 3: Combine Vegetables

In a large mixing bowl, pour in the matchstick carrots. Add finely diced onion and dried cranberries.

Step 4: Mix in Apples

Once they’ve soaked, add the apple pieces to your vegetable mixture.

Step 5: Prepare Dressing

In the same bowl, add vanilla yogurt and mayo. Then sprinkle in sugar, salt, and pepper.

Step 6: Combine Everything

Stir all ingredients thoroughly until everything is well coated with dressing.

Step 7: Add Mandarins

Gently fold in canned mandarin segments into your salad mix.

Step 8: Chill

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least three hours to let flavors meld together.

Step 9: Serve

Take out from refrigerator, garnish with parsley if desired, serve chilled, and enjoy!

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making Carrot Apple Salad, avoiding common mistakes can elevate the dish’s flavor and presentation.

  • Not using fresh ingredients: Fresh apples and carrots make a significant difference in taste. Always choose crisp apples and crunchy carrots for the best salad.
  • Skipping the lemon juice: Omitting lemon juice can lead to browning apples. This step not only keeps the apples vibrant but also adds a zesty flavor.
  • Overmixing the dressing: Mixing too vigorously can break down the ingredients, making the salad mushy. Gently fold the dressing into the salad to maintain texture.
  • Neglecting to chill: Failing to refrigerate the salad for at least three hours can result in flavors not melding together well. Allowing it to chill enhances the overall taste.
  • Using too much sugar: Adding excess sugar can overpower the salad’s natural sweetness. Stick to one tablespoon for balance.

Frequently Asked Questions

What can I add to my Carrot Apple Salad?

You can customize your Carrot Apple Salad by adding nuts, such as walnuts or pecans, for extra crunch. Raisins or other dried fruits also work well!

Can I make Carrot Apple Salad ahead of time?

Yes! You can prepare this salad a day in advance. Just keep it covered in the refrigerator until you’re ready to serve.

How do I make a vegan version of Carrot Apple Salad?

To make a vegan version of Carrot Apple Salad, substitute vanilla yogurt with plant-based yogurt and use vegan mayo instead of regular mayo.

Is Carrot Apple Salad healthy?

Absolutely! This salad is loaded with vitamins from fruits and vegetables while being low in calories. It’s a great side dish or snack option.
